Alexander Valley, California

You love their Cabernets and Chardonnays, wait ‘til you taste this!


90 Points The Wine Advocate
“The 2018 Sauvignon Blanc Estate leaps from the glass with gregarious white peach, grapefruit and lemon curd scents plus hints of elderflower, chopped herbs and pea pods. Medium-bodied, the palate is charged with electric citrus and herb flavors plus a super racy backbone,
finishing on a peachy note. ”


Our Thoughts...............
Planted between 500 and 1,000 ft. elevation.
It reflects thealtitude, rock-driven vineyard soils and showcases exotic fruit character grounded by mineral components.
Aromas of lemon and Thai basil on the nose, with background notes of pear and lemon blossom to add intrigue.
On the palate, great depth is on full display, with a broad, rich texture counter
balanced by good acidity and superb length bolstered by flavors of fennel, peach and lemon zest.

Their Story, their words..........

Ranging in elevation from 400ft to 2400ft,
Stonestreet Estate Vineyards stands as the one largest and most extensive mountain vineyards in the world. Towering high above the Alexander Valley in the Mayacamas Mountain Range, Stonestreet Estate defies all previous conceptions of winegrowing.
Single vineyard blocks are aligned in every imaginable spot on the compass, with peaks, valleys and ridges creating a broad spectrum of varied facings and elevations.

Winegrowers throughout history have looked to high elevation sites with impoverished, rocky soils to produce richly concentrated wines of character. Mountain vineyards are notoriously difficult to farm, and Stonestreet Estate is no exception.
The Estate’s myriad of vine spacing, and broad array of elevation and mesoclimate require a vine-by-vine approach to winegrowing.

As harvest approaches, our winemaking team works closely with Mother Nature to determine quality levels for each block, walking the vineyards and tasting berries for flavor and tannin maturation. The selection process is a stringent one, but the rewards are unmistakable: Cabernet Sauvignon, Chardonnay and Sauvignon Blanc etched with the bold and distinctive flavor profile of the Mayacamas Mountain Range.
